Novel Antifungal Scaffold Targeting Tubulin Overcomes Sclerotinia Sclerotiorum Resistance

open access: yesAdvanced Science, EarlyView.
Addressing pesticide resistance, novel chromone‐acylhydrazone hybrids targeting fungal tubulin are synthesized. Compound G24 potently inhibited S. sclerotiorum (EC50 = 0.21µg mL−1) and demonstrated enhanced field performance via microencapsulation, offering a sustainable strategy against resistance and for global food security.

Phocaeicola coprophilus‐Derived 6‐Methyluracil Attenuates Radiation‐Induced Intestinal Fibrosis by Suppressing the IDO1‐Kynurenine‐AHR Axis

open access: yesAdvanced Science, EarlyView.
IR‐induced dysbiosis depletes P. coprophilus and its metabolite 6‐methyluracil, leading to disinhibition of the IDO1‐Kyn‐AHR axis. This results in sustained fibroblast activation and collagen deposition, driving radiation induced intestinal fibrosis.
